What Is a Domain Name Transfer Code?

Definition

A domain name transfer code is a unique alphanumeric code assigned to a domain name. It is used to authorise and secure the transfer of a domain from one registrar to another. The code ensures that the transfer request is legitimate and prevents unauthorised transfers.

Also Known As

  • Authorisation Code
  • EPP Code (Extensible Provisioning Protocol Code)
  • Auth Code
  • Transfer Key

Why Do You Need a Domain Name Transfer Code?

Security

The primary purpose of the transfer code is to ensure that only the authorised domain owner can initiate a transfer. This security measure helps prevent domain hijacking and unauthorised changes.

Verification

The code acts as a verification tool, confirming that the request to transfer the domain is genuine. Both the current registrar and the new registrar use the code to validate the transfer.

Smooth Transition

Having the correct transfer code helps facilitate a smooth transition of domain ownership. Without it, the transfer process may be delayed or rejected.

How to Obtain a Domain Name Transfer Code

1. Log In to Your Registrar Account

To obtain a transfer code, first log in to your account with the current domain registrar. At Lightyear Hosting, you can access your account via our StackCP control panel.

2. Locate the Domain Management Section

Navigate to the domain management section where your registered domains are listed.

3. Request the Transfer Code

Find the domain name you wish to transfer and select the option to request or view the transfer code. This option is typically available under domain settings or management options.

4. Check Your Email

After requesting the transfer code, you will receive it via email from your current registrar. Make sure to check your inbox and spam folder for this important message.

5. Contact Support if Needed

If you encounter any issues obtaining your transfer code, contact your registrar’s support team. At Lightyear Hosting, our support team is available to assist you with any questions or problems you may have regarding domain transfers.

How to Use a Domain Name Transfer Code

1. Initiate the Transfer Request

Once you have the transfer code, initiate the transfer request with your new registrar. At Lightyear Hosting, you can start this process through our domain transfer page.

2. Enter the Transfer Code

During the transfer process, you will be prompted to enter the transfer code. Input the code exactly as it appears in the email you received.

3. Confirm the Transfer

Follow the instructions provided by your new registrar to confirm and finalise the transfer. This typically involves approving the transfer request via email or through your account dashboard.

4. Monitor the Transfer Process

Keep an eye on the transfer process to ensure that it completes successfully. The transfer may take several days to finalise, depending on the registrars involved.

Frequently Asked Questions

How Long Does a Domain Transfer Take?

The transfer process typically takes between 5 to 7 days, depending on the registrars involved. You will receive notifications throughout the process to keep you informed.

What Should I Do If I Don’t Receive the Transfer Code?

If you do not receive the transfer code, contact your current registrar’s support team for assistance. Ensure that your domain is unlocked and eligible for transfer.

Can I Transfer a Domain That Is Close to Expiry?

Yes, you can transfer a domain close to expiry. However, it is advisable to initiate the transfer well before the expiry date to avoid any potential issues.
